In the world of industrial machinery, efficient coolant management is crucial for maintaining operational efficacy. One of the most practical solutions for optimizing coolant systems is the use of a coolant collector. This piece of equipment plays a significant role in ensuring sustainability, cost savings, and overall equipment longevity.

1. Improved Efficiency of the Cooling System

According to John Smith, a sustainability expert at Industrial Dynamics, "Implementing a coolant collector can drastically improve the performance of your cooling system by reducing the workload on pumps and other components." The reduced circulation strain leads to better operational efficiency and lower energy consumption.

2. Environmental Benefits

Jane Doe, an environmental engineer, emphasizes the importance of eco-friendliness: "Using a coolant collector minimizes waste and reduces the risk of contamination in manufacturing processes." This not only protects the environment but also helps businesses comply with regulatory standards.

3. Cost-Effective Solution

Mark Thompson, a financial analyst specializing in industrial investments, states, "The long-term savings generated through the reduced need for coolant replenishment and lowered disposal costs make a coolant collector a wise financial decision." By reclaiming and reusing coolant, companies can significantly cut operational expenses.

4. Enhanced Equipment Longevity

According to Ellen Roberts, a mechanical engineer with over 20 years of experience, "A coolant collector helps keep machinery clean and well-maintained by preventing contaminants from entering the system." This, in turn, prolongs the lifespan of equipment, reducing the need for premature replacements or repairs.

5. Increased Safety Measures

Robert Lee, a safety consultant, adds, "Coolant collectors play a crucial role in enhancing workplace safety. By reducing coolant spillage and leaks, they minimize slip hazards and potential fire risks associated with flammable substances." Investing in such technology fosters a safer working environment.

6. Simplified Maintenance Procedures

Jessica Green, a maintenance manager, notes that "Implementing a coolant collector streamlines maintenance tasks. Maintenance teams can focus on urgent repairs rather than dealing with coolant disposal and replenishment." This increased focus allows for better overall system management.

7. Optimized Resource Management

Lastly, Tom Adams, a resource management expert, highlights the importance of tracking coolant usage. "A coolant collector facilitates precise tracking of coolant consumption, enabling companies to optimize resource allocation and improve their operational strategies." This optimization leads to enhanced productivity and reduced waste.

Overall, the installation of a coolant collector not only enhances the efficiency and sustainability of a coolant system but also addresses various operational challenges faced by industries today. By embracing this essential technology, businesses can ensure better performance, safety, and environmental responsibility.
